Why Sugar-Free Candy Can Improve Your Oral Health

You might think of candy as a dental indulgence, but the right sugar-free options can be a strategic tool for oral health. The primary benefit comes from stimulating saliva production. Saliva is your body’s first line of defense against tooth decay and gum disease, as it naturally rinses away food particles and neutralizes harmful acids.

When your mouth is dry, this natural defense system is compromised, creating an environment where bacteria can thrive, leading to both bad breath and an increased risk of cavities. Sucking on a sugar-free candy or lozenge encourages your salivary glands to get to work.

The key, of course, is the "sugar-free" part. Candies sweetened with sugar would counteract any benefits by feeding the very bacteria you’re trying to manage. Instead, oral health candies use sugar substitutes like xylitol, which not only avoids fueling bacteria but can actively inhibit their growth.

XyliMelts Discs for Lasting Overnight Relief

Waking up with a dry, uncomfortable mouth is a common challenge, particularly for those who breathe through their mouth at night or take medications that cause dryness. Constant sips of water can disrupt sleep, but there are more targeted solutions. XyliMelts offer a unique approach designed specifically for long-lasting, overnight relief.

These small, adhesive discs stick discreetly to your gums or teeth. This design allows them to slowly release xylitol and a gentle moisturizer over several hours. The result is a sustained increase in saliva and a lubricating effect that can last all night, promoting more comfortable sleep and a healthier oral environment upon waking.

Unlike a lozenge you might accidentally swallow, the adhering disc stays put. This makes it a safe and effective "set it and forget it" solution for managing nocturnal dry mouth, a crucial part of maintaining restorative sleep and oral health without interruption.

TheraBreath Lozenges to Target Bad Breath Bacteria

Sometimes, the primary concern isn’t just dryness, but the bad breath that often accompanies it. While any saliva-stimulating lozenge helps, TheraBreath Dry Mouth Lozenges are formulated to directly address the root cause of halitosis.

These lozenges contain specific ingredients, including zinc compounds, that are clinically recognized for their ability to neutralize the volatile sulfur compounds (VSCs) produced by oral bacteria. It’s these VSCs that are responsible for the unpleasant odor of bad breath. So, while the lozenge stimulates saliva to wash bacteria away, its active ingredients are also working to neutralize odors on a chemical level.

This makes them an excellent choice for maintaining social confidence throughout the day. A quick lozenge after a meal or before a meeting can provide immediate freshness and the lasting benefit of a more balanced, moisturized mouth.

Spry Mints: A Natural Choice for Healthy Saliva

For those who prefer products with a simple, natural-focused ingredient list, Spry Mints are an excellent option. Their formula is centered on the power of xylitol, which is a plant-derived sugar alcohol known for its significant oral health benefits.

Spry products are notable for using xylitol as the principal sweetener. This is important because studies suggest xylitol not only moisturizes by drawing moisture into the mouth but also has properties that make it difficult for plaque-producing bacteria to stick to teeth. Regular use can help create an oral environment that is less hospitable to decay.

Available in a variety of natural flavors, these mints offer a refreshing and simple way to stimulate saliva and protect your teeth between brushings. They are a great choice for a quick refresh after meals or anytime you need a boost of moisture without artificial additives.

Zollipops: The Kid-Friendly Candy for Adult Teeth

Don’t let the playful packaging fool you; Zollipops were created with serious dental science in mind. While marketed to kids, their unique formulation makes them a fantastic and enjoyable option for adults looking to maintain a healthy oral pH.

These sugar-free lollipops are sweetened with xylitol and erythritol and contain other natural ingredients. Their key function is to help neutralize acid in the mouth after a meal. Acidic conditions weaken tooth enamel, but raising the oral pH back to a neutral state helps teeth remineralize and stay strong.

Having a Zollipop after a meal or acidic drink is a fun, effective way to combat acid attacks and stimulate saliva. They prove that supporting your long-term dental health doesn’t have to feel clinical or boring, and they’re a great treat to have on hand for visiting grandchildren, too.

Key Ingredients to Look for in Oral Health Candies

When you’re standing in the pharmacy aisle, looking at dozens of options, knowing what to look for on the ingredient label is empowering. Not all sugar-free candies are created equal when it comes to oral health benefits.

Here are the key players to identify:

  • Xylitol: This is the gold standard. It’s a natural sugar alcohol that moisturizes the mouth and has been shown to inhibit the growth of Streptococcus mutans, the primary bacteria responsible for cavities.
  • Erythritol: Another sugar alcohol that, like xylitol, does not feed harmful oral bacteria and helps stimulate saliva.
  • Zinc Compounds: Look for ingredients like zinc gluconate or zinc acetate. These are highly effective at neutralizing the sulfur compounds that cause bad breath, targeting the problem at its source.
  • Sorbitol and Mannitol: These are other common sugar alcohols used for sweetness. While they don’t have the same anti-bacterial punch as xylitol, they are non-cariogenic, meaning they don’t contribute to tooth decay.

By looking for products that feature one or more of these ingredients, you can be confident you’re choosing a candy that does more than just taste good—it actively contributes to a healthier, more comfortable mouth.
